The map is a printed vinyl decal adhered to MDF. It featured a path of fiber optic dots to follow the path of the show from city to city.
Vinyl map decal, printed on stick back vinyl by a sign company. It was applied to an MDF surface.
The city to city path created with fiber optics. Each dot contains 4 fiber strands. See data sheet below for all of the fiber optics facts.
Fiber bundles on the back of the map. Each dot has 4 fibers; each city to city path was bundled to install in the light boxes at load in.
Fiber strands poking through the map surface. They were later clipped flush after install.
The fiber optic umbilical was threaded through the black curtain to the backstage operating position.
Light boxes for fiber optics control.

Each dot was glued into the light box. Each dot bundle was labeled to ensure they were installed in the correct order.

The fiber bundles were lit using standard high wattage "A" Lamps.
The complete set with the slider panels, gears, and map in the background. The set played in rep with the kids show, Rapunzel.
The slider panel referencing the cities along the journey was rigged on heavy duty drawer glides so it could be hid behind the proscenium.

The timetable signs were rigged on heavy duty drawer glides so it could be hid behind the proscenium.
